#asktheexperts My daughter have 8 month and 3 week... she has not yet grown teeth... any problem doctor?

2 Answers
ExpertDr. Garima VermaDentist3 years ago
A. no it is completely okay. some kids get their teeth a little late. you can wait till the age if 18 months for the first tooth to erupt in your baby's mouth

A. Hello good evening!! Generally babies Start teething around 7-11 months but for few it takes time 13-15 months. As baby is 8.5 months only no need to worry. Give fruits and vegetables puriees, mashes, cerelac, mashed rice, Diary products. Mild Fever, motions, crankiness, rejecting feed, hard, swollen gums are teething symptoms if so soothe baby gums with teethers, soothers for easing gum pain.
